From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-0.5 required=3.0 tests=DKIM_ADSP_CUSTOM_MED, DKIM_INVALID,DKIM_SIGNED,FREEMAIL_FORGED_FROMDOMAIN,FREEMAIL_FROM, HEADER_FROM_DIFFERENT_DOMAINS,MAILING_LIST_MULTI,SPF_PASS,URIBL_BLOCKED autolearn=ham aut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 5A5ECC32789 for ; Sun, 4 Nov 2018 17:11:34 +0000 (UTC) Received: from krantz.zx2c4.com (krantz.zx2c4.com [192.95.5.69]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id D1E9620685 for ; Sun, 4 Nov 2018 17:11:33 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=fail reason="signature verification failed" (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="jcaGkv34" D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org D1E9620685 Authentication-Results: mail.kernel.org; dmarc=fail (p=none dis=none) header.from=gmail.com Authentication-Results: mail.kernel.org; spf=pass smtp.mailfrom=wireguard-bounces@lists.zx2c4.com Received: from krantz.zx2c4.com (localhost [IPv6:::1]) by krantz.zx2c4.com (ZX2C4 Mail Server) with ESMTP id a41dc81b; Sun, 4 Nov 2018 17:07:25 +0000 (UTC) Received: from krantz.zx2c4.com (localhost [127.0.0.1]) by krantz.zx2c4.com (ZX2C4 Mail Server) with ESMTP id 9c40055b for ; Mon, 22 Oct 2018 01:15:44 +0000 (UTC) Received: from mail-wm1-x32e.google.com (mail-wm1-x32e.google.com [IPv6:2a00:1450:4864:20::32e]) by krantz.zx2c4.com (ZX2C4 Mail Server) with ESMTP id 38d61f6f for ; Mon, 22 Oct 2018 01:15:44 +0000 (UTC) Received: by mail-wm1-x32e.google.com with SMTP id 189-v6so8528169wmw.2 for ; Sun, 21 Oct 2018 18:18:10 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:from:date:message-id:subject:to; bh=EWL03WzzEOZmHdCNzHsLklaNYegXx6/nL8Xq/u9gjgs=; b=jcaGkv34GeBXyExV2AyfZF8c31hLUaVAbAlCSaFdZjuQKtVY+vM0gvAJEGsCEShxNQ Bt8wdtuGWNDXWwd1/Ns9xujlCeX04M7wvv1zzo3OvQTGLUGMRATH1GGs3XcKQlZ4axVT JD3+R/om76cwlyPT0YYChOIWTR9zEbpLGwEddSXhnClGrVjd1eUE2xxISti2JRrQQp5F 2tc1VahKPSYk5ssCJFt70UzPhSQ6NmKL9Yb27aOZtxE8l5+ACU5X1VN6ZcEQeNhnuUQz SieBLtxh1xODEWSK+oo2cbehdlVTkKvfSvCPveVYzA97J34cSgdnWcTEmqIiLLBWhNyS yHEw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:from:date:message-id:subject:to; bh=EWL03WzzEOZmHdCNzHsLklaNYegXx6/nL8Xq/u9gjgs=; b=CFt0FVFrmMDaqMjzLTjoVaAcaWfa7ISwxMmZgcy6q0rfWhg/lptarQjwkSb00gPCDg BmEaF9Ci/2zS4SJ3cnSXMwwsbh+MfjlxRokmxxORUj9ADRIr7U0c4Pw3uySYjO1LNIp4 vh+1o1UXXbss8IzWBkev9XcEvav0o2H5/vxTiFMq8YdqiUyLseBenxNuznpnrV7+cfuM 5xv/hM6a3jS2Q1s40OEHFF7RWY46NHTCE95HkoOlIMqVLjhEQ7gtqqeq4v6mhJFfdQJA PBjbezhJ+kWX8AuW1FdMry2WJPKuXs8K9ceBERQ8/z/pzuN8Ac/pHawRhs+T0JlcrPjb KjVQ== X-Gm-Message-State: ABuFfoir66YqJ71Z8zoTygjVzlk8BFbjC65Z7fzxRI/PDVuLZEaHN0m6 TBZOI6AfYWZbfAQj2NcTCT3XltBd2/b71blz0YjbBa59nKw= X-Google-Smtp-Source: ACcGV62Z3eYboDCuJjx6osVbz7qIt1jnj55spLCW2y5dJ5IHjof27wuMMWGzh+dBbZlSxeZktluRQScd5uGf379hKF4= X-Received: by 2002:a1c:ae15:: with SMTP id x21-v6mr13194570wme.73.1540171088096; Sun, 21 Oct 2018 18:18:08 -0700 (PDT) MIME-Version: 1.0 From: Love4Taylor Date: Mon, 22 Oct 2018 09:17:56 +0800 Message-ID: Subject: Google Play can't Download through Kernel module backend To: wireguard@lists.zx2c4.com X-Mailman-Approved-At: Sun, 04 Nov 2018 18:07:23 +0100 X-BeenThere: wireguard@lists.zx2c4.com X-Mailman-Version: 2.1.15 Precedence: list List-Id: Development discussion of WireGuard List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Errors-To: wireguard-bounces@lists.zx2c4.com Sender: "WireGuard" Hi, I recently discovered that when I use the Kernel module backend, Google Play will always be stuck in Downloading, I got the following logcat, but everything works fine when using Go module backend (Android VPN). D DownloadManager: [558] Starting W DownloadManager: [514] Stop requested with status HTTP_DATA_ERROR: SSL handshake aborted: ssl=0x766f2a4008: I/O error during system call, Connection reset by peer D DownloadManager: [514] Finished with status WAITING_TO_RETR D DownloadManager: [558] Starting W DownloadManager: [555] Stop requested with status HTTP_DATA_ERROR: failed to connect to r1---sn-3qqp-ioqsl.gvt1.com/27.85.180.172 (port 443) from /10.0.0.101 (port 49253) after 20000ms D DownloadManager: [555] Finished with status HTTP_DATA_ERROR I think it should not be a server problem, even if I use the free server provided by TunSafe, it is the same problem. It seems that the DownloadManager called by Google Play has not passed Wireguard at all(10.0.0.101 is my LAN IP). Then I did the following test. Kernel module backend + Router blocks Google domain name: Google Play stuck in Downloading, the log is the same as above. Go module backend + Router blocks Google domain name: Everything works fine, no error log. Kernel module backend + Router does not block Google domain name: Everything works fine, no error log. My Phones: OG Pixel/Nexus6 (Both are Android 9) The link is route etc. on my phone: http://ix.io/1n8q _______________________________________________ WireGuard mailing list WireGuard@lists.zx2c4.com https://lists.zx2c4.com/mailman/listinfo/wireguard